Floor Lamp
Floor lamps are a great way to add height and elegance to a room while using minimum floor space. They are also to move around, from place to place or room to room. And moving their pools of light into new corners can give a totally new mood. They can even look good in hallways.
Rug
A rug is a common addition to a hard surface floor such as hardwood, laminate, or tile. Not only can it change the look and mood of a room, they also have a range of practical benefits – from warming your home, to reducing noise and protecting your floor.
